A leading provider of integrated marine and subsea services is hiring Survey Engineers for an exciting offshore role in Aberdeen. The ideal candidate will have a background in electronics or data technology, with strong problem-solving skills and a commitment to safety and innovation.
This position involves operating and maintaining survey equipment, collaborating with teams, and contributing to ongoing technological advancements. Join us in shaping the future of energy with a focus on sustainability and teamwork.

How to prepare for a job interview at DOF
✨Know Your Tech
Brush up on your knowledge of survey equipment and data technology. Be ready to discuss specific tools you've used and how they relate to the role. Showing that you understand the technical aspects will impress the interviewers.
✨Safety First
Since safety is a key focus for this position, prepare examples of how you've prioritised safety in past roles. Think about situations where you identified risks and implemented solutions. This will demonstrate your commitment to maintaining a safe working environment.
✨Show Your Problem-Solving Skills
Prepare to share instances where you've tackled complex problems, especially in an offshore or technical context. Use the STAR method (Situation, Task, Action, Result) to structure your answers and highlight your innovative thinking.
✨Teamwork Makes the Dream Work
Collaboration is crucial in this role, so be ready to discuss your experience working in teams. Share how you've contributed to group projects and how you handle conflicts. Emphasising your ability to work well with others will resonate with the interviewers.
